An Example: The Pubic Symphysis
One clear example of a cartilaginous joint is the pubic symphysis, located at the front of your pelvis. And this joint connects the left and right pubic bones, forming a sturdy bridge between your lower body’s two halves. In practice, while it doesn’t allow much movement, it does permit slight flexibility—enough to help with activities like walking, lifting, or even childbirth. It’s a fibrocartilaginous joint, meaning it’s reinforced with dense connective tissue called fibrocartilage. The pubic symphysis plays a critical role in absorbing shock and distributing forces across the pelvis, especially during high-impact activities or heavy lifting Turns out it matters..

How Cartilaginous Joints Work
Structure of the Pubic Symphysis
The pubic symphysis is a textbook example of a fibrocartilaginous joint. At its core, there’s a thin layer of fibrocartilage sandwiched between the ends of the two pubic bones. This cartilage is tough and resilient, designed to handle compression and shear forces. Surrounding the joint is a thin layer of connective tissue, but unlike synovial joints, there’s no joint capsule or lubricating synovial fluid. Instead, the fibrocartilage itself acts as a shock absorber And that's really what it comes down to..
Movement and Function
While the pubic symphysis allows only about 3–5 millimeters of movement, this small range is crucial. It lets the pelvis shift slightly during activities like running or jumping, preventing damage to surrounding tissues. During childbirth, this flexibility becomes even more critical. The joint stretches enough to allow the baby’s passage through the birth canal—a testament to its adaptive capacity.
Healing and Repair
Fibrocartilage has limited blood supply, which means healing in these joints can be slow. If the pubic symphysis is injured—say, from a fall or repetitive strain—it may take weeks or even months to recover. In severe cases, surgery might be necessary to repair or stabilize the joint.

Overexertion Without Support
Another critical error is engaging in high-impact activities or heavy lifting without adequate core and pelvic stability. The pubic symphysis relies on surrounding musculature—like the abdominals, glutes, and pelvic floor—to distribute forces evenly. When these muscles are weak or misaligned, excessive strain falls directly on the symphysis, increasing the risk of microtears, inflammation, or even a pelvic fracture. Neglecting Postpartum Recovery
A frequent oversight occurs after childbirth, when the focus shifts entirely to the newborn while the birthing parent’s pelvic rehabilitation is sidelined. The pubic symphysis undergoes significant hormonal softening (driven by relaxin) and mechanical stretching during delivery. Without targeted postpartum rehabilitation—specifically pelvic floor physical therapy and progressive core strengthening—the joint may remain unstable long after the initial healing window. This neglect can lead to persistent symphysis pubis dysfunction (SPD), chronic pelvic girdle pain, and altered gait patterns that stress the lower back and hips for years.

Diagnosis and Management
Accurate diagnosis begins with a thorough clinical history and physical examination, including palpation of the symphysis, assessment of pelvic ring mobility, and provocative tests like the flamingo (single-leg stance) test. Imaging plays a supporting role: X-rays can reveal widening of the joint space (>10 mm suggests instability) or osteitic changes, while MRI is the gold standard for visualizing bone marrow edema, disc degeneration, and soft tissue inflammation without radiation exposure That alone is useful..
Management is typically stratified. For refractory cases, image-guided injections (corticosteroid or platelet-rich plasma) into the symphysis or surrounding ligaments can bridge the gap to exercise tolerance. In practice, Conservative care remains the cornerstone: activity modification (avoiding single-leg loading like lunges or stair climbing), a structured physical therapy program targeting the deep core, gluteals, adductors, and pelvic floor, and short-term NSAID use. Surgical fusion (arthrodesis) is a last resort, reserved for severe instability or pain unresponsive to six to twelve months of exhaustive non-operative care, carrying a significant recovery period and permanent loss of the joint’s minimal but vital mobility Worth keeping that in mind..
